How much do warehouse operations associ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for warehouse operations associate in Utah is $15.76,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.99 and $16.63 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a warehouse operations associate?

Warehouse Operations Associates are responsible for handling the daily tasks that keep warehouse facilities running smoothly. Their duties typically include receiving and processing incoming stock, picking and filling orders, organizing inventory, and ensuring the warehouse remains clean and safe. They may also operate machinery such as forklifts, package shipments, and use inventory management systems. Strong attention to detail, physical stamina, and teamwork skills are important for success in this role.

What is the difference between Warehouse Operations Associate vs Warehouse Clerk?

AspectWarehouse Operations AssociateWarehouse Clerk
ResponsibilitiesInventory management, order picking, shipping/receivingData entry, record keeping, labeling
Required SkillsPhysical stamina, basic computer skills, organizationData entry, attention to detail, computer proficiency
Work EnvironmentWarehouse floor, active physical workOffice or administrative area within warehouse
CertificationsNone typically required, OSHA safety training beneficialNone typically required

The Warehouse Operations Associate and Warehouse Clerk roles often overlap in warehouse settings, but the associate focuses more on physical tasks like inventory handling and order fulfillment, while the clerk handles administrative duties such as data entry and record keeping. Both roles require basic skills and safety awareness, but the associate's work is more physically demanding and hands-on.

Warehouse Associate
About the Role
We are seeking a reliable and detail-oriented Warehouse Associate to join our team. In this role, you will support the full flow of warehouse operations - from receiving and inventory handling to packing and shipping outbound orders. You'll work across several functions including wire cutting and light assembly, while helping keep assigned areas clean, organized, and running smoothly.
Key Responsibilities
  • Perform core warehouse functions including receiving, picking, packing, shipping, wire cutting, and light assembly
  • Complete daily log sheets and process inbound shipments
  • Verify supplier returns and accurately enter order receipts into the system
  • Relocate and consolidate materials to maintain organized inventory
  • Prepare and assemble packing lists for outgoing orders
  • Pack, label, wrap, and load outbound trucks
  • Maintain general cleanliness and upkeep of assigned work areas
Skills & Requirements
  • Basic computer skills preferred
  • Strong basic problem-solving abilities
  • Ability to lift up to 50 pounds
  • Ability to stand and remain on your feet for extended periods
  • Willingness to learn and operate warehouse equipment, including power equipment
